Форум SAPE.RU

Форум SAPE.RU (http://forum.sape.ru/index.php)
-   Установка кода на различные движки (http://forum.sape.ru/forumdisplay.php?f=26)
-   -   неправильно передаете переменную в шаблон (http://forum.sape.ru/showthread.php?t=9622)

aptizzzt 29.02.2008 18:14

неправильно передаете переменную в шаблон
 
Друзья, я уж вообще не знаю что делать

В саппорте дошел до этой рекомендации и все...
Видимо вы неправильно передаете переменную в шаблон или в какую либо функцию, где производится непосредственно вывод ссылок.

Движком никаким не пользуюсь, сайт самописный на ПХП

<?php
global $sape;
if (!defined('_SAPE_USER')){
define('_SAPE_USER', 'абракадабра');
}
require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');

$o[ 'force_show_code' ] = true;
$sape = new SAPE_client( $o );

echo $sape->return_links();
?>

Где-то прочитал что мой сервер может неправильно передавать значение DOCUMENT_ROOT.

Поменял строку
require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');
на
require_once('http://manhattan.in.ua'.'/'._SAPE_USER.'/sape.php');
Ситуация не меняется. По прежнему ничего не отображается...

zhegloff 29.02.2008 18:18

Цитата:

Сообщение от aptizzzt (Сообщение 95231)
require_once('http://manhattan.in.ua'.'/'._SAPE_USER.'/sape.php');

Жжоте.

aptizzzt 29.02.2008 18:22

чего??
ну разве что в своих програмистских познаниях %)

zhegloff 29.02.2008 18:27

верните назад

require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');

Поставьте перед if (!defined('_SAPE_USER')){

строку

error_reporting
(E_ALL);

а перед

$o[ 'force_show_code' ] = true;

строку
$o[ 'verbose' ] = true;

И читайте, что напишет.


aptizzzt 29.02.2008 18:39

Дык, ничего не пишет :confused:

Вот код

<?php
global $sape;
error_reporting(E_ALL);
if (!defined('_SAPE_USER')) {
define('_SAPE_USER', 'абракадабра');
}
require_once($_SERVER['DOCUMENT_ROOT'].'/'._SAPE_USER.'/sape.php');

$o[ 'verbose' ] = true;
$o[ 'force_show_code' ] = true;
$sape = new SAPE_client( $o );

echo $sape->return_links();
?>

zhegloff 29.02.2008 18:53

Вообще ничего?

Уберите global $sape;

и дайте сайт в личку.

aptizzzt 29.02.2008 19:21

скинул

zhegloff 29.02.2008 19:56

Ну так цифрокод на сайте есть, что именно не работает то?

aptizzzt 29.02.2008 23:18

Ну так в вроде должен отображаться код в виде
<---чето там--->
И вообще, гогда я нажимаю проверить наличие кода, від\ает что код не найден.

Ank 29.02.2008 23:26

хм.
Дело в следующем... чеккод как надпись - ДО добавления сайта. После 10ти циферный ЧК.
Модерация была? В систему добавились? длинная последовательность в названии папки - точно ваша?


Часовой пояс GMT +3, время: 03:26.

Работает на vBulletin® версия 3.8.7.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ot
SAPE.RU — система купли-продажи ссылок с главных и внутренних страниц сайтов.